-
TypeScriptで依存性注入を行う際の型安全性を確保する方法
依存性注入(DI)は、ソフトウェア開発において、オブジェクトが自身で依存するオブジェクトを直接生成するのではなく、外部から供給される仕組みです。これにより、コ... -
TypeScriptでの依存性注入コンテナの作成方法と実践例を徹底解説
TypeScriptにおける依存性注入(Dependency Injection、DI)は、クラスやモジュール間の依存関係を管理し、コードの柔軟性やテストのしやすさを向上させるために重要な... -
TypeScriptでサービスロケーターを使った依存性注入の仕組みを解説
TypeScriptにおける依存性注入(Dependency Injection、DI)は、コードの柔軟性とメンテナンス性を向上させるための重要な設計パターンです。特に、DIを利用することで... -
TypeScriptでシングルトンパターンを活用した依存性管理方法を徹底解説
TypeScriptにおいて、依存性の管理はアプリケーションの構造をシンプルにし、コードの再利用性や保守性を向上させる重要な要素です。特に、複雑なアプリケーションでは... -
TypeScriptのデコレーターを使った依存性注入の実装方法を徹底解説
TypeScriptにおけるデコレーターと依存性注入は、クリーンなコードを実現し、柔軟なアーキテクチャを構築するための重要な手法です。依存性注入(Dependency Injection... -
TypeScriptでインターフェースを使った依存性注入の実装方法
TypeScriptを使用した開発において、コードの保守性や拡張性を高めるための設計手法として依存性注入(Dependency Injection)が重要な役割を果たします。依存性注入は... -
TypeScriptでクラスコンストラクタを使用した依存性注入の方法を徹底解説
TypeScriptにおける依存性注入は、コードの再利用性や拡張性を向上させるための重要な設計手法です。特に、クラスのコンストラクタを利用した依存性注入は、シンプルか... -
TypeScriptにおける依存性注入の基本とその実践的な仕組み
依存性注入(DI)は、ソフトウェア設計において、クラスやモジュールが必要とする依存オブジェクトを外部から提供する設計パターンです。これにより、クラス間の結びつ... -
TypeScriptでデコレーターを使ったクラス間の動的プロパティ共有法
TypeScriptは、強力な静的型付けと柔軟な構文を持つことで、JavaScriptのスーパーバージョンとして多くの開発者に支持されています。特に、デコレーターと呼ばれる機能...